Grubbing in Houston, TX

Grubbing services involve the removal of unwanted roots, stumps, and debris from residential properties to prepare land for landscaping, construction, or lawn installation. This process typically covers projects such as clearing land for new construction, removing tree stumps after tree removal, or tidying up overgrown areas. Property owners interested in grubbing should consider the extent of the root system, the size of the stumps or debris, and the desired final landscape to ensure the service meets their needs effectively.

Before requesting grubbing services,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including whether the project requires excavation or specialized equipment. It’s also helpful to clarify if the service includes removal and disposal of debris, as well as any potential impact on surrounding structures or underground utilities. Having a clear idea of the project’s goals can help ensure the process is completed efficiently and aligns with the property’s future use.

Project Types

Common Grubbing Jobs

Tree and shrub removal - clearing overgrown or damaged plants to improve landscape safety and appearance.

Stump grinding - removing tree stumps to create a smooth, safe yard surface and prevent pests.

Land clearing - preparing land for construction, gardening, or landscaping by removing unwanted vegetation.

Grubbing services - excavating roots, rocks, and debris to level and prepare the ground for new projects.

Site excavation - removing soil and vegetation to create a stable foundation for structures or landscaping.

Root removal - extracting invasive or problematic roots to protect existing trees and structures.

FAQ

Grubbing Questions

What is grubbing service? Grubbing involves removing tree stumps, roots, and debris from a property to prepare for landscaping or construction projects.

When should property owners consider grubbing? Grubbing is useful when clearing land for new construction, landscaping, or preventing root-related issues.

What types of projects typically require grubbing? Projects such as building new structures, installing lawns, or creating outdoor spaces often need grubbing services.

What should property owners know before scheduling grubbing? It's important to assess the extent of root systems and debris to determine the scope of the work needed.
